Transaction ef51a04e2671d25cdd0b633007f37ccc974b6f8798a0d10a93d882d94cbe5fa8
1 Input
1 Output
-
ef51a04e2671d25cdd0b633007f37ccc974b6f8798a0d10a93d882d94cbe5fa8:0
- value
- 409694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c80a1798ecdc89f0e3bdf4debba24212a7b37cef OP_EQUAL
- address
- 3KvjA8J9RicvpPQCZxrfBmgaZ6Bfuh89xV